# CVE-2026-20319

> 7.5 HIGH

## Beschreibung

As part of Cisco's ongoing commitment to proactive security and product quality, the Cisco Secure Workload engineering team has conducted a comprehensive internal security review. This review resulted in a software hardening release that addresses multiple internally discovered vulnerabilities.

The vulnerabilities tracked by CVE-2026-20319 are related to buffer management issues that are grouped under the Common Weakness Enumeration (CWE) CWE-119.

## Schwachstellen-Klasse

- **CWE-119** — Improper Restriction of Operations within the Bounds of a Memory Buffer
  The product performs operations on a memory buffer, but it reads from or writes to a memory location outside the buffer's intended boundary. This may result in read or write operations on unexpected memory locations that could be linked to other variables, data structures, or internal program data.
